CHURCHILL CLOSE - streets of Stewartby (England).
Explore "CHURCHILL CLOSE" on the map of Stewartby in street view mode
Click on the buttons below to display the map of CHURCHILL CLOSE, Stewartby, United Kingdom
Tags:
CHURCHILL CLOSE on the map of Stewartby,
Stewartby satellite view, Stewartby street view.
Source: Ordnance Survey Open Data